Instructions
To Make the Buckeyes Peanut Butter Base
  1. Line a baking tray with parchment paper and set aside.

  2. In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with a paddle attachment (or using a handheld electric mixer), add the peanut butter, butter, and vanilla extract and mix on medium-high speed until fully combined.

  3. With the mixer on low speed, add the powdered sugar, one spoonful at a time and mix until smooth.

  4. Using a 1 tablespoon measuring spoon, divide the dough into 24 pieces and roll them into balls. Refrigerate until firm, about 1 hour.

To Make the Buckeyes Chocolate Coating
  1. In a medium microwave-safe bowl, add the chocolate and coconut oil and heat in 30 second intervals until melted. Allow the mixture to cool to room temperature.

To Assemble the Buckeyes
  1. Using a skewer, dip each peanut butter ball in the melted chocolate leaving the top of the ball exposed. Place the dipped buckeyes on the prepared trays and refrigerate until firm, about 30 minutes.

To Serve and Store the Buckeyes
  1. Enjoy with a cup of coffee! Store leftover buckeyes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.
